Launched today (Sunday, August 1), www.venezuelasolidarity.org.uk/ says it is organized by progressive people within Britain, aimed at helping to explain to a British audience what is happening in Venezuela and to promote and support Venezuela Solidarity work.

Venezuelasolidarity, like VHeadline.com is wholly in support of www.vheadline.com/readnews.asp?id=6822 the 1999 Venezuela Constitution and subsequent social and economic changes that have the massive support of an overwhelming majority of the poorest (80%) of the Venezuelan population.

A formal launch, with the support of key British Trade Unions and Labour movement political parties, is planned for next year.

It aims to get the support of all people in Britain who believe in the right of all people in Latin America to self determination and has the support of those who oppose coups and fascists interventions. The organizers say they will contact all British MPs over the course of the next few months and that all other suggestions for work and activities will be welcomed.

In advance of next year's work, they will be building a database of solidarity work and promoting activities in advance of the referendum. In the meantime, webmaster Andy Goodall says readers in Britain and across Europe will watch and anticipate the Presidential referendum decision on Sunday August 15. “We wish for the Venezuelan people the greatest victory possible after 40 years of poverty … by reaffirming support for President Hugo Chavez, the massive improvements in health and education can be extended still further and real, fundamental progress can be made.”

www.venezuelasolidarity.org.uk/ encourages all people to support the progress being made and oppose coups and terrorists backed by multi-billionaire business and media owners.
